Choose WPEDA for standard duty; choose WPEDS for high-duty-cycle or hot-ambient applications where the combined motor and two-stage heat generation exceeds the smooth-body WPEDA&#8217;s thermal capacity.<\/p>\n<\/details>\n<details style=\"background:#e8f5e9;border:1px solid #a5d6a7;border-radius:8px;padding:2.5%;margin:0.7em 0;\">\n<summary style=\"font-weight:bold;color:#1a3a1a;cursor:pointer;font-size:clamp(13px,1.7vw,16px);\">How much hotter does a two-stage motor-direct drive run compared to a single-stage?<\/summary>\n<p style=\"line-height:1.75;margin:0.7em 0 0;\">A motor-direct two-stage drive generates heat from three sources simultaneously: motor winding, first-stage worm mesh, and second-stage worm mesh. In practice, a WPEDA in a 40\u00b0C plant room may reach 88\u201392\u00b0C oil sump temperature at rated load \u2014 close to the 95\u00b0C limit. The WPEDS reduces this to 70\u201375\u00b0C \u2014 comfortable headroom even at 45\u00b0C ambient. For rubber and plastics applications running 16+ hours per day, this thermal margin is the primary reason for specifying WPEDS over WPEDA.<\/p>\n<\/details>\n<details style=\"background:#e8f5e9;border:1px solid #a5d6a7;border-radius:8px;padding:2.5%;margin:0.7em 0;\">\n<summary style=\"font-weight:bold;color:#1a3a1a;cursor:pointer;font-size:clamp(13px,1.7vw,16px);\">Can I replace a WPEDA with a WPEDS without machine modification?<\/summary>\n<p style=\"line-height:1.75;margin:0.7em 0 0;\">Yes, in most cases. If clearance is sufficient, it is a direct swap.<\/p>\n<\/details>\n<details style=\"background:#e8f5e9;border:1px solid #a5d6a7;border-radius:8px;padding:2.5%;margin:0.7em 0;\">\n<summary style=\"font-weight:bold;color:#1a3a1a;cursor:pointer;font-size:clamp(13px,1.7vw,16px);\">What synthetic lubricant extends WPEDS thermal performance further?<\/summary>\n<p style=\"line-height:1.75;margin:0.7em 0 0;\">For ambient temperatures above 40\u00b0C or applications where oil sump temperatures may approach 80\u00b0C even with the WPEDS fins, we recommend upgrading from ISO VG 320 mineral oil to <strong>synthetic PAG ISO VG 460<\/strong>. PAG oils offer substantially higher thermal stability, lower friction coefficients (reducing gear heat generation as well as managing it), and drain intervals of 5,000+ hours in many applications \u2014 providing a further thermal margin on top of the fin-array benefit.<\/p>\n<\/details>\n<details style=\"background:#e8f5e9;border:1px solid #a5d6a7;border-radius:8px;padding:2.5%;margin:0.7em 0;\">\n<summary style=\"font-weight:bold;color:#1a3a1a;cursor:pointer;font-size:clamp(13px,1.7vw,16px);\">Does the WPEDS require any special maintenance for the fin array?<\/summary>\n<p style=\"line-height:1.75;margin:0.7em 0 0;\">For standard industrial environments, no special fin maintenance is required. In dusty environments (rubber powder, plastic dust, chemical particulate), inspect fin channels annually and clean with compressed air if accumulation is visible. In WPEDS applications where VSD operation at low speeds is used, ensure adequate plant ventilation or air circulation around the fin array \u2014 natural convection is less effective when the unit is stationary or running very slowly.<\/p>\n<\/details>\n<\/section>\n<section style=\"background:linear-gradient(135deg,#1a3a1a,#0a1a0a);border-radius:12px;padding:3%;margin-bottom:1em;text-align:center;color:#fff;\">\n<h2 style=\"font-size:clamp(16px,2.5vw,24px);margin:0 0 0.6em;\">  The Complete Thermal Solution for Motor-Direct Two-Stage Drives<\/h2>\n<p style=\"line-height:1.8;max-width:680px;margin:0 auto 1.4em;font-size:clamp(13px,1.7vw,16px);\">If your motor-direct two-stage drive is approaching thermal limits in a hot or continuous-duty environment, the WPEDS delivers the integrated solution.
